Credentialed Alcohol & Substance Abuse Counselor (CASAC)

University of Rochester · Rochester, New York Metropolitan Area · 2 mo ago
Healthcare$22.45–$30.31/hrFull-time

Responsibilities

  • Conduct comprehensive intake evaluations with individuals seeking treatment for substance use disorders.
  • Assess substance use history, including type, frequency, and patterns of use, along with the psychological, medical, social, legal, vocational, and educational impacts.
  • Review prior treatment history and evaluate motivation for change, psychological dependence, personal resources, and relevant family history.
  • Prepare written and verbal clinical reports for multidisciplinary intake review and diagnostic conferences while maintaining required productivity and documentation standards.
  • Communicate with patients and collaborate with healthcare providers, social service agencies, employers, and criminal justice partners, ensuring compliance with confidentiality laws and patient rights.
  • Provide information to the treatment team to support diagnostic assessment and care planning.
  • Provide individual counseling within a structured treatment plan for individuals with substance use disorders.
  • Use strong listening, empathy, supportive confrontation, and motivational skills to support patient engagement, treatment participation, and long-term recovery.
  • Communicate treatment team decisions and collaborate with interdisciplinary team members as patient needs evolve.
  • Maintain accurate clinical documentation, including treatment plans, progress notes, updates, discharge summaries, and interagency communications.
  • Apply knowledge of the psychological, behavioral, social, and physical effects of substance use, including alcohol, opiates, stimulants, sedatives, and hallucinogens.
  • Understand treatment approaches such as detoxification, medication-assisted treatment, drug-free programs, and the use and limitations of drug screening tools.
  • Utilize community resources including detox programs, rehabilitation services, residential treatment, vocational support, and self-help programs.
  • Support group counseling processes, participate in continuing education and in-service training, and engage in regular clinical supervision.
